在电商搜索领域,人工智能发挥着怎样的作用?...Etsy数据科学主管洪亮劼来到了数据侠实验室×阿里云天池,他以案例为基,从人工智能技术在电商中的基本应用、电商人工智能技术与传统领域的异同等方面出发,为大家带来了一场以“人工智能技术在电商搜索的落地应用...电商搜索则与普通搜索有着很大的差别,在传统搜索中最受重视的相关性并非电商搜索的全部,只是电商搜索的一方面而已。而电商搜索更需要关注总体利润,能否通过搜索来产生效益。...但电商推荐与传统推荐又有何不同?...卖家希望用最少的钱打到最好的效果;买家希望买到最好的东西;平台则希望在这个交易过程中利益最大化。如何将三种不同诉求的目标统一在同一建模中,这对于电商广告系统而言又是一大挑战。
远丰电商最近了解到:建立独立站对于跨境电商来说无非是最好的,同时对于跨境电商的卖家而言,独立站并不陌生,独立站的意义也已经非常明显,不仅能为卖家发展保驾护航,同时,独立站与平台之间还能巧妙搭配运营,帮助平台吸引更多的精准流量...下面小编给大家介绍一下为什么要搭建跨境电商平台? 一,建立跨境电商独立站有哪些优势?...在海外市场,如美国,以亚马逊为主的电商平台占据了超过40%的在线零售总额,但是仍然有超过50%的在线零售总额是在电商独立商城上完成的。...而在日本,三个最大的电商平台占在线市场零售总额的40%,还有60%的空间是通过在线独立平台完成的,这些数据表明做平台有非常大的空间和机会,同时做独立商城的运营也可以帮助到卖家获取广阔的市场空间,因为有非常多的消费者群体会选择独立站进行购物...以上就是远丰电商的小编给大家介绍的为什么要搭建跨境电商平台?想要搭建属于自己的跨境电商平台可以点击远丰电商的官网进行咨询以及查看更多!
前几节呢,我们已经简单介绍了SpringBoot框架的使用,从这一节开始,我们尝试着使用SpringBoot框架来一步一步搭建一个简单电商项目。...当然了,这不是真正的电商项目,你可以看成是一个CRUD案例,只是应用到了SpringBoot框架而已。 开发工具:eclipse 数据库:MySQL 1.新建项目 ? ? ? ?... mysql-connector-java ...url: jdbc:mysql://127.0.0.1:3306/db_shop username: root password: 123456 jpa: hibernate...: ddl-auto: update show-sql: true 数据库采用我本地的MySQL 再次启动,终于不报错了。
这两个月来,很多小伙伴留言问我618、双11各大电商后端的技术,最多的是关于系统压力暴增情况下如何进行MySQL数据库优化的。 今天就结合我自己工作中的真实案例和大家分享一下吧。...最初的技术选型,采用的是Java语言进行开发,数据库使用的是MySQL;后面出现性能瓶颈的时候,我们采取了MySQL主从同步和应用服务端读写分离的方案,暂时解决了MySQL压力问题。...这里我给大家推荐一个免费的Mysql实训营,我朋友诸葛老师关于大厂数据库Mysql优化的分享——《高并发Mysql性能优化与海量数据架构实战》,4天时间下来,你可以收获像我一样的优化MySQL数据库的实战经验...►9月14日-9月17日每晚8点,集训四天,吃透Mysql 这个特训营课程一共有4天时间,通过这个课程: 让你对高并发系统Mysql性能调优以及海量数据处理架构有一个深度的理解,深度掌握Mysql底层优化原理...课程中分享的大厂内部项目、618亿级数据优化实践、国内顶级电商数据处理架构……让你积累到可用于面试和工作的经验。
但是java的开发效率就太落后了,而且开发成本通常较高,现在大多数电子商务企业几乎不会考虑用java去开发,毕竟技术一直向前发展,如果用java开发商城,就好比让一个老太太去踢足球一样,简直是笑掉大牙。...为什么JAVA在某些部分存在着众多不足,如:运行效率、学习难易、开发工具不足、界面,但开发较大的项目胜任有余,原因就在于,架构上的优势获得的效率远比于上述这些东西的影响要大。...反过来说,为什么那么多Windows服务器中招?...LAMP技术 如今,使用LAMP(Linux、Apache、MySQL和PHP/Perl)架构的应用程序不断被开发和部署。...Linux、Apache、MySQL和PHP(或Perl)是许多Web应用程序的基础——从to-do列表到blog,再到电子商务站点。
为什么电商平台开始与物流公司产生矛盾? 进入到今年以来,特别是进入到后“互联网+”发展阶段以来,有关电商平台与物流公司不和的新闻不绝于耳。...人们不禁要问,为什么在以往电商平台能够与物流公司和平共处,偏偏在这个时候开始心生芥蒂呢? 首先,物流公司有自己的渠道拓展用户,不再单一地依靠电商平台。...如果仅仅只是充当平台的作用,而不介入到电商领域的相关环节,那么电商平台的盈利空间将会越来越少。在这样一种情况下,通过深度发掘每一个环节的盈利空间,才能拉动电商平台新一轮的增长。...正是因为以上三个方面的原因,我们才会看到物流公司与电商平台之间的矛盾开始不断出现。未来随着电商平台更加深度地介入物流行业,预计还将会有会更多的物流企业与电商平台产生矛盾。...电商平台本身所具备的物流行业的性质让其与物流公司本身有着某种天然的竞争关系,随着电商平台赢利点的不断挖掘,未来将会有更多的物流公司将会加入到与电商平台的竞争当中。
面试官心理分析 其实面试官主要是想看看: 第一,你知不知道你们系统里为什么要用消息队列这个东西? 不少候选人,说自己项目里用了 Redis、MQ,但是其实他并不知道自己为什么要用这个东西。...其实说白了,就是为了用而用,或者是别人设计的架构,他从头到尾都没思考过。 没有对自己的架构问过为什么的人,一定是平时没有思考的人,面试官对这类候选人印象通常很不好。...面试题剖析 为什么使用消息队列 其实就是问问你消息队列都有哪些使用场景,然后你项目里具体是什么场景,说说你在这个场景里用消息队列是什么?...但是系统是直接基于 MySQL 的,大量的请求涌入 MySQL,每秒钟对 MySQL 执行约 5k 条 SQL。...一般的 MySQL,扛到每秒 2k 个请求就差不多了,如果每秒请求到 5k 的话,可能就直接把 MySQL 给打死了,导致系统崩溃,用户也就没法再使用系统了。
常见电商项目的数据库表设计(MySQL版) 简介: 目的: 电商常用功能模块的数据库设计 常见问题的数据库解决方案 环境: MySQL5.7 图形客户端,SQLyog Linux 模块: 用户:注册、登陆...商品:浏览、管理 订单:生成、管理 仓配:库存、管理 电商实例数据库结构设计: 电商项目用户模块 用户表涉及的实体 改进1:第三范式:将依赖传递的列分离出来。...ALTER TABLE customer_login_log DROP PARTITION p2 4.根据需要可以把归档的表引擎改为 ARCHIVE 5.分区数据归档迁移条件 6.操作步骤 mysql...’, supplier_code CHAR(8) NOT NULL COMMENT ‘供应商编码’, supplier_name CHAR(50) NOT NULL COMMENT ‘供应商名称’,...supplier_type TINYINT NOT NULL COMMENT ‘供应商类型:1.自营,2.平台’, link_man VARCHAR(10) NOT NULL COMMENT ‘供应商联系人
编辑:业余草 来源:cnblogs.com/laoyeye/p/8228467.html 使用MySQL悲观锁解决并发问题 昨天写了乐观锁《使用MySQL乐观锁解决电商扣库存并发问题》,有人提出想看悲观锁...注:要使用悲观锁,我们必须关闭mysql数据库的自动提交属性,因为MySQL默认使用autocommit模式,也就是说,当你执行一个更新操作后,MySQL会立刻将结果进行提交。...补充:MySQL select…for update的Row Lock与Table Lock 上面我们提到,使用select…for update会把数据给锁住,不过我们需要注意一些锁的级别,MySQL...InnoDB默认Row-Level Lock,所以只有「明确」地指定主键,MySQL 才会执行Row lock (只锁住被选取的数据) ,否则MySQL 将会执行Table Lock (将整个数据表单给锁住...lock) console1: mysql> begin; Query OK, 0 rows affected mysql> select * from t_goods where id
正交表一般用Ln(mk)表示,L 代表是正交表,n 代表试验次数或正交表的行数,k 代表最多可安排影响指标因素的个数或正交表的列数,m 表示每个因素水平数,且有 n=k*(m-1)+1。...五、总结 利用因果图法、判定表法可以帮助我们对于输入数据的组合情况进行用例设计,但当输入数据的组合数量巨大时,由于不太可能覆盖到每个输入组合的测试情况,因果图法或判定表法可能就不太适用了,可以采用正交实验法
想必大家生活中,也经常用到淘宝,京东等电商平台网购,假货问题一直是电商行业的痛点,而对于跨境电商的“假货”问题更是备受诟病。利用区块链技术,让跨境贸易变得更“可信”正成为越来越多电商巨头的选择。...“京东全球购是首个在全链条采用区块链技术溯源的跨境电商平台。”京东Y事业部区块链技术应用负责人刘斯漪表示,目前已经有数万商品可以实现“一键溯源”,“我们的目标是推广到所有的产品”。...刘斯漪介绍到,借助区块链技术,将这些品牌商的商品原材料过程、生产过程、流通过程、营销过程的信息进行整合并写入区块链。...该联盟成员包括中国出入境检验检疫协会等行业权威机构,沃尔玛、好奇、达能、莎莎、Rakuten、ebay精选等20大全球知名品牌商以及德迅、亚致力等国际性的货运服务商等合作伙伴,覆盖美国、德国、日本、法国等全球热门的跨境电商商品输出国...联盟成立后,保税备货和跨境直邮两种形式的跨境电商供应链信息已被打通。
简介: 目的: 电商常用功能模块的数据库设计 常见问题的数据库解决方案 环境: MySQL5.7 图形客户端,SQLyog Linux 模块: 用户:注册、登陆 商品:浏览、管理 订单:生成、管理 仓配...:库存、管理 电商实例数据库结构设计 电商项目用户模块 用户表涉及的实体 ?...', supplier_code CHAR(8) NOT NULL COMMENT '供应商编码', supplier_name CHAR(50) NOT NULL COMMENT '供应商名称...ordermaster orderdetail ordercustomeraddr ordercart shippinginfo warehouseinfo warehouse_product 参考 高性能可扩展MySQL...数据库设计及架构优化 电商项目,sqlercn,https://coding.imooc.com/class/79.html
DBbrain具备实时诊断优化、安全高效、效果可预见、掌上管理、AI助力、多场景兼容的6大特性,会上,刘迪结合今年双十一DBbrain支持腾讯云上电商客户大促的案例为大家深入解读了DBbrain的系统架构...电商大促的保障工作为备战准备、大促保障、节后复盘三个阶段,DBbrain可为电商客户在每个阶段都提供智能化的数据库保障,例如:健康巡检、资源评估、优化改造、监控大屏、故障处理、应急止损以及经验总结等。...在电商大促进行时,传统的监控很难提供一个关注所有数据库实时状态的全局视野。
、Drupal、Jommla这三家知名建站程序一致推荐的主机商。...,后期域名多了也不便于管理,所以去一个专门注册域名的服务商注册,方便后期统一管理。...因为我们用过很多不同空间商的主机,多年经验总结下来就是,如果做国内站,那就老老实实到国内买一个空间备案使用,这样是最稳定的方案。...我们上图中的价格也是涨价后的价格,从2020年开始,他们开始使用了google云的机房,他们解释的大概意思是“目前找不到比google更强的云服务器”,不知道亚马逊算不算:) 还有siteground以前用的都是...至于为什么放弃cpanel,siteground自己解释说cpanel授权太贵,所以不用,不过我比较好奇的是既然放弃了cpanel,省掉了这部分授权费用,为什么主机反而涨价了。。。
点击上方蓝色字体,选择“设为星标” 回复”学习资料“获取学习宝典 一,前言 首先说明一下MySQL的版本: mysql> select version(); +-----------+ |...为什么会出现上面的结果?我们看一下select * from test where val=4 limit 300000,5;的查询过程: 查询到索引叶子节点数据。...MySQL耗费了大量随机I/O在查询聚簇索引的数据上,而有300000次随机I/O查询到的数据是不会出现在结果集当中的。...肯定会有人问:既然一开始是利用索引的,为什么不先沿着索引叶子节点查询到最后需要的5个节点,然后再去聚簇索引中查询实际数据。这样只需要5次随机I/O,类似于下面图片的过程: 其实我也想问这个问题。...也证实了为什么第一个sql会慢:读取大量的无用数据行(300000),最后却抛弃掉。
导读:用了这么久MySQL ,用 limit 为什么会影响性能?...前言 ---- 首先说明一下MySQL的版本: mysql> select version(); +-----------+ | version() | +-----------+ | 5.7.17...为什么会出现上面的结果?我们看一下select * from test where val=4 limit 300000,5;的查询过程: 查询到索引叶子节点数据。...肯定会有人问:既然一开始是利用索引的,为什么不先沿着索引叶子节点查询到最后需要的5个节点,然后再去聚簇索引中查询实际数据。这样只需要5次随机I/O,类似于下面图片的过程 其实我也想问这个问题。...也证实了为什么第一个sql会慢:读取大量的无用数据行(300000),最后却抛弃掉。
一,前言 首先说明一下MySQL的版本: mysql> select version(); +-----------+ | version() | +-----------+ | 5.7.17...为什么会出现上面的结果?我们看一下select * from test where val=4 limit 300000,5;的查询过程: 查询到索引叶子节点数据。...MySQL耗费了大量随机I/O在查询聚簇索引的数据上,而有300000次随机I/O查询到的数据是不会出现在结果集当中的。推荐:MySQL 索引B+树原理,以及建索引的几大原则。...肯定会有人问:既然一开始是利用索引的,为什么不先沿着索引叶子节点查询到最后需要的5个节点,然后再去聚簇索引中查询实际数据。这样只需要5次随机I/O,类似于下面图片的过程: ?...也证实了为什么第一个sql会慢:读取大量的无用数据行(300000),最后却抛弃掉。
一,前言 首先说明一下MySQL的版本: mysql> select version(); +-----------+ | version() | +-----------+ | 5.7.17...为什么会出现上面的结果?我们看一下select * from test where val=4 limit 300000,5;的查询过程: 查询到索引叶子节点数据。...MySQL耗费了大量随机I/O在查询聚簇索引的数据上,而有300000次随机I/O查询到的数据是不会出现在结果集当中的。...肯定会有人问:既然一开始是利用索引的,为什么不先沿着索引叶子节点查询到最后需要的5个节点,然后再去聚簇索引中查询实际数据。这样只需要5次随机I/O,类似于下面图片的过程: 其实我也想问这个问题。...也证实了为什么第一个sql会慢:读取大量的无用数据行(300000),最后却抛弃掉。
一,前言 首先说明一下MySQL的版本: mysql> select version(); +-----------+ | version() | +-----------+ | 5.7.17...为什么会出现上面的结果?我们看一下select * from test where val=4 limit 300000,5;的查询过程: 查询到索引叶子节点数据。...肯定会有人问:既然一开始是利用索引的,为什么不先沿着索引叶子节点查询到最后需要的5个节点,然后再去聚簇索引中查询实际数据。这样只需要5次随机I/O,类似于下面图片的过程: 其实我也想问这个问题。...也证实了为什么第一个sql会慢:读取大量的无用数据行(300000),最后却抛弃掉。...://dev.mysql.com/doc/refman/5.7/en/innodb-information-schema-buffer-pool-tables.html
一.前言 首先说明一下MySQL的版本: mysql> select version(); +-----------+ | version() | +-----------+ | 5.7.17...为什么会出现上面的结果?我们看一下select * from test where val=4 limit 300000,5;的查询过程: 查询到索引叶子节点数据。...MySQL耗费了大量随机I/O在查询聚簇索引的数据上,而有300000次随机I/O查询到的数据是不会出现在结果集当中的。...肯定会有人问:既然一开始是利用索引的,为什么不先沿着索引叶子节点查询到最后需要的5个节点,然后再去聚簇索引中查询实际数据。这样只需要5次随机I/O,类似于下面图片的过程: 其实我也想问这个问题。...也证实了为什么第一个sql会慢:读取大量的无用数据行(300000),最后却抛弃掉。
领取专属 10元无门槛券
手把手带您无忧上云